Nursery Business Administrator (Marketing-Focused) – Apprenticeship Role Responsibilities
- Assist with daily administrative tasks to ensure efficient and smooth nursery operations.
- Support the management team with problem-solving activities and business decision-making processes.
- Manage schedules, appointments, parent meetings, and nursery events to optimise time management.
- Provide exceptional customer service by handling parent enquiries, managing admissions queries, and ensuring a positive first impression of the nursery.
- Utilise IT systems to maintain accurate records, update parent databases, and streamline administrative processes.
- Support the nursery’s marketing efforts, including managing and updating social media platforms, assisting with website updates and online content, creating newsletters, promotional materials, and parent communications, supporting open days, community events, and enrolment campaigns, and monitoring engagement and helping to grow the nursery’s local presence and reputation.
